Understanding Common Patio Door Lock Issues

Patio door locks, while designed for security, are vulnerable to wear and tear in time due to frequent use and exposure to the aspects. Numerous typical problems can demand patio door lock repair. Recognising these issues can help you comprehend the seriousness and kind of service you may require.

Typical Patio Door Lock Problems:

  • Sticky or Jammed Locks: This is a frequent problem often triggered by dirt, particles, or rust build-up within the lock system. Often, it's due to misaligned doors causing friction, avoiding the bolt from smoothly engaging.
  • Broken or Damaged Locking Mechanisms: Internal components of the lock can break due to age, wear, or attempted forced entry. This might involve damaged latches, cylinders, or other internal parts that are essential for the lock's function.
  • Loose or Wobbly Handles and Hardware: Over time, screws can loosen, triggering handles and locking hardware to end up being wobbly or detached. This not just feels insecure however can likewise impact the lock's appropriate functioning.
  • Stripped Screws or Damaged Frames: Attempting DIY repairs or powerful operation can sometimes damage the screw holes in the door frame or door itself, making it hard to securely reattach the lock.
  • Key Issues: Keys might become bent, damaged, or lost, or the lock cylinder itself might become worn, making it hard to insert or turn the secret.
  • Misalignment Problems: Settling structures, fluctuating temperatures, or use and tear on rollers and tracks can cause patio doors to misalign. This misalignment can put stress on the locking mechanism, making it difficult to lock or open correctly, and sometimes even avoiding it totally.
  • Indications of Forced Entry: If you discover any indications of tampering, such as scratches, damages, or forced parts around the lock, instant expert repair and potentially improved security measures are crucial.

Do it yourself Attempt vs. Professional Patio Door Lock Repair

Faced with a defective patio door lock, house owners may think about a DIY repair technique to conserve expenses. While some small issues might be taken on with fundamental tools and a bit of know-how, more complex problems are best left to specialists.

When DIY Might Be Possible (and When It's Not):

  • Simple Tightening: Loose screws on handles or hardware can frequently be tightened with a screwdriver. This is a straightforward DIY repair.
  • Lubrication: Sticky locks due to dirt and particles can sometimes be solved with a silicone-based lubricant. Using lube into the keyhole and moving parts can sometimes maximize a jammed mechanism.
  • Fundamental Cylinder Replacement (If Experienced): If you are comfy with fundamental locksmithing principles and have prior experience, you may be able to replace a standard cylinder if you have the right replacement part.

The Cost of Patio Door Lock Repair

The expense of patio door lock repair can vary depending on several elements:

Factors Influencing Repair Costs:

  • Type of Lock: Simple latches are usually less costly to repair than more complex multi-point locking systems or high-security locks.
  • Degree of Damage: Minor changes or lubrication will be less expensive than replacing damaged parts or dealing with substantial damage.
  • Kind Of Service (Emergency vs. Scheduled): Emergency repairs beyond regular service hours typically sustain higher fees.
  • Components Replacement: The cost of replacement parts will include to the overall expense. Specialty locks or older designs might have more expensive parts.
  • Labor Costs: Labor rates differ based on the company's location and experience.
  • Service Call Fee: Many service fee a service call or assessment fee, even if no repair is eventually performed. Clarify this upfront.

General Cost Estimates (These are approximate and vary by location and specific issue):

  • Simple Adjustments/Lubrication: ₤ 50 - ₤ 150
  • Standard Lock Cylinder Replacement: ₤ 75 - ₤ 250
  • More Complex Mechanism Repair/Replacement: ₤ 150 - ₤ 400+
  • Emergency Service Fees: Can include ₤ 50 - ₤ 100+ to the base cost.

Always get a detailed quote before continuing with any repair work to avoid surprises.

Preventative Maintenance for Patio Door Locks

Routine maintenance can significantly extend the lifespan of your patio door locks and prevent pricey repairs.

Patio Door Lock Maintenance Tips:

  • Regular Cleaning: Clean the lock system and hardware periodically with a soft brush to remove dirt and particles.
  • Lubrication: Apply a silicone-based lubricant to the keyhole, bolt, and moving parts of the lock at least twice a year, or whenever you notice stiffness. Avoid oil-based lubes as they can draw in dust and gunk.
  • Look For Loose Screws: Periodically inspect deals with, hardware, and the lock itself for loose screws and tighten them as needed.
  • Check Door Alignment: Check for indications of door misalignment. If you see problem locking or opening, or if the door drags or sticks, address positioning issues immediately.
  • Smooth Roller and Track Maintenance: Ensure the patio door rollers and tracks are tidy and oiled for smooth operation, reducing strain on the locking system.
